ENVIRONMENT-FRIENDLY DISINFECTANT COMPOSITION, FOR PREVENTING INFECTIOUS DISEASE, HAVING EXCELLENT ANTIMICROBIAL AND DEODORIZING PERFORMANCE BY CONTAINING LIQUID SODIUM SILICATE, AND ENVIRONMENT-FRIENDLY DISINFECTANT, FOR PREVENTING INFECTIOUS DISEASE, COMPRISING SAME

The present invention relates to an environment-friendly disinfectant composition, for preventing an infectious disease, having an excellent antimicrobial and deodorizing performance, and an environment-friendly disinfectant, for preventing an infectious disease, comprising same, the disinfectant composition comprising: 10 to 45 weight% of liquid sodium silicate; 10 to 45 weight% of one or more natural product-derived extracts selected from the group consisting of a green tea seed extract, a saururus extract, phytoncide oil, a pyroligneous acid, and a mixture thereof; and the remaining amount of distilled water. The liquid sodium silicate is prepared by means of a preparation method comprising: a material mixing step for mixing 0.001 to 0.01 parts by weight of molybdenum compound relative to 100 parts by weight of main material in which silica stone powder and sodium carbonate are mixed at a weight ratio of 1: 0.9 to 1; a heat-melting step for inputting the material, which has been mixed in the material mixing step, to a crucible and heat-melting at 2000-2200°C for 7 to 11 hours; a molten material cooling step for cooling the molten material which has been heat-melted in the heat-melting step; a grinding step for grinding the molten material, which has been cooled and solidified in the molten material cooling step, to an average particle diameter of 0.2 to 4.0 mm; a primary dissolving step for inputting 15 to 22 parts by weight of ground material, which has been ground in the grinding step, to 100 parts by weight of water and primarily dissolving at 100-120°C for 3 to 4 hours; a secondary dissolving step for inputting the dissolved material, which has been primarily dissolved in the primary dissolving step, to 180 to 250 parts by weight of water and secondarily dissolving at 100-120°C for 3 to 4 hours; and a step for obtaining liquid sodium silicate by cooling the dissolved material which has been secondarily dissolved in the secondary dissolving step. Therefore, the environment-friendly disinfectant composition minimizes the possibility of various bacteria or virus infections to effectively prevent and follow up on infectious diseases, and, particularly, is injected on agricultural wastes or animals which have been buried or died due to an infectious disease, to reduce odor and prevent secondary infection as well as ensure safety for human health and the environment and prevent environmental pollution.
